WebOnions are grown for green-topped salad onions and dry bulb onions. Select a loose, fertile soil and start with transplants, small dry bulbs (sets), or seeds. Set out transplants in late winter and early spring, depending on location, and use for both salad and bulb onions. Onion sets planted in early spring also produce salad onions and bulbs.

WebNov 6, 2024 · by Lillie Nelson. November 6, 2024. The best way to keep onions and frost apart is with simple mulch. Use an organic mulch that is at least 2 inches (5 cm.) deep when cold and freezing temperatures are expected.
